Birmingham Ormiston Academy and BOA Digital Technologies Academy are secondary schools in Birmingham.

  • Birmingham Ormiston Academy scores 61 out of 100 (grade C, average) and BOA Digital Technologies Academy scores 46 out of 100 (grade D, below average). Birmingham Ormiston Academy is ahead on our composite score.

  • Birmingham Ormiston Academy was judged Good and BOA Digital Technologies Academy was judged the expected standard.
